    SIS Security Salary 2026: In-Hand Pay, 8-Hour vs 12-Hour, Slip & City-Wise Breakdown

    YogeshBy YogeshSeptember 8, 2026
    SIS Security Salary

    SIS Security (Security and Intelligence Services / SIS Limited) pays its entry-level unarmed security guards a gross salary of roughly ₹14,000 to ₹18,000 per month on an 8-hour shift, and ₹19,000 to ₹25,000 per month on a 12-hour shift (which includes daily overtime). After statutory deductions such as PF and ESI, the in-hand SIS Security salary usually works out to ₹12,000–₹15,500 (8 hours) and ₹16,000–₹21,500 (12 hours), depending on the city, client site, and state minimum wage rate. Supervisors and officers earn more — typically ₹19,000 to ₹32,000 in hand.

    Since SIS does not publish one fixed, nationwide pay scale, these are indicative ranges built from state minimum-wage patterns, employee-reported payslips, and job-platform salary data — not a single official figure.

    Who Is SIS Security and How Does Pay Work Here?

    SIS Limited (formerly Security and Intelligence Services) is India’s largest listed manned-guarding company, headquartered in New Delhi and founded in Patna in the 1970s. It is the only NSE/BSE-listed pure-play security services company in India, holds PSARA (Private Security Agencies Regulation Act, 2005) licenses across states, and deploys guards at banks, IT parks, malls, airports, industrial units, and residential complexes.

    Because SIS is a large, formally organised employer, salary structures follow the state-wise minimum wage notification for the “security guard/watchman” category, plus company-specific allowances. This is why the same designation can pay differently in Delhi versus Jaipur or Varanasi — it isn’t inconsistency, it’s how minimum-wage-linked private security payroll works across India.

    SIS Security Salary Structure: Basic, Gross, and In-Hand Are Not the Same

    A common mistake candidates make is treating “salary” as one number. At SIS, like most organised security firms, there are four distinct figures:

    • Basic Pay + DA: The core wage component, usually aligned to the state’s notified minimum wage for the “unskilled” or “semi-skilled” security category.
    • Gross Salary: Basic + DA + HRA + other allowances (washing, uniform, special allowance), before any deductions.
    • In-Hand (Net) Salary: What actually reaches the bank account after EPF, ESI, professional tax, and any other deductions are subtracted from gross.
    • CTC: Rarely quoted at the guard level, but for supervisory and officer roles it may include the employer’s PF and ESI contribution and any bonus components on top of the gross salary.

    Never assume Gross Salary = In-Hand Salary. The gap is typically ₹1,500 to ₹3,500 per month at the guard level, mainly due to EPF and ESI.

    SIS Security Salary 8 Hours vs 12 Hours

    This is one of the most searched questions about SIS Security salary, and the difference comes almost entirely from overtime, not a different pay scale.

    • SIS Security Salary 8 Hours: A standard single shift. Gross pay is generally ₹14,000–₹18,000/month, translating to an in-hand salary of about ₹12,000–₹15,500. This is common at government offices, corporate back-offices, and light-duty commercial sites.
    • SIS Security Salary 12 Hours: Includes roughly 4 hours of daily overtime (OT) on top of the standard shift. Because OT is calculated at a premium rate, gross pay rises to ₹19,000–₹25,000/month, with in-hand pay around ₹16,000–₹21,500. This shift pattern is more common at industrial sites, ATMs, construction projects, and 24×7 facilities.

    Practical note: choosing a 12-hour posting is the single biggest lever a guard has to increase take-home pay, since overtime hours are paid in addition to the base minimum wage.

    Allowances Included in SIS Security Salary

    Where applicable, an SIS employee’s gross pay may include:

    • Dearness Allowance (DA): Bundled with Basic Pay in most state minimum-wage notifications; revised twice a year (April and October) in several states.
    • House Rent Allowance (HRA): A fixed percentage or amount, more common for guards deployed away from their hometown.
    • Washing/Uniform Allowance: A small fixed monthly amount to maintain the SIS uniform.
    • Overtime (OT) Pay: Applicable for 12-hour shifts or extra duty days, calculated over and above the basic wage rate.
    • SIS Award/Incentive: An attendance or performance-linked incentive that appears as a separate line in some payslips for guards with zero unauthorised leave in a month.

    Deductions from SIS Security Salary

    • EPF (Employees’ Provident Fund): 12% of Basic + DA is deducted from the employee, matched by an equal 12% employer contribution. This goes into the guard’s retirement savings account and is not a loss — it is deferred income.
    • ESI (Employees’ State Insurance): Applicable when gross wages are at or below ₹21,000/month. The employee share is 0.75% of gross wages, and the employer contributes 3.25% (total 4%), as per ESIC rules in force since July 2019. ESI coverage provides medical and sickness benefits.
    • Professional Tax: State-specific and typically a small monthly amount (varies from ₹0 in some states to around ₹200 in others, depending on the salary slab and state law).
    • Labour Welfare Fund (LWF): A very small statutory deduction (often ₹10–₹30/month) applicable in certain states.

    What Actually Reaches Your Bank Account: A Sample Calculation

    Here is an illustrative, assumption-based calculation for an 8-hour shift guard with a gross salary of ₹16,000/month. This is not an official SIS figure — it is a worked example to show how the numbers move.

    Component Amount
    Basic Pay + DA ₹13,000
    HRA ₹2,000
    Washing/Other Allowance ₹1,000
    Gross Salary ₹16,000
    EPF (12% of Basic+DA) – ₹1,560
    ESI (0.75% of Gross) – ₹120
    Professional Tax (assumed) – ₹150
    Total Deductions ≈ ₹1,830
    Approximate In-Hand Salary ≈ ₹14,170

    For a 12-hour shift with a gross of ₹22,000 (including OT), the in-hand figure typically lands around ₹19,500–₹20,500, since OT components are usually excluded from EPF wages and ESI eligibility can shift once gross regularly crosses ₹21,000. Actual numbers will differ by site and state — always check your own payslip rather than relying on averages.

    How to Read and Get Your SIS Security Salary Slip

    SIS Limited runs its payroll and attendance through centralised HR/operations systems used across its branch network, so salary slips are computer-generated and typically show: Basic+DA, HRA, extra-duty/OT amount, bonus allowance, and deductions for PF, ESI, professional tax, and LWF, followed by “Total Earnings,” “Total Deduction,” and “Net Payable.”

    To get your SIS Security salary slip online, the practical route is:

    1. Ask your site supervisor or branch HR for login access to the employee self-service system used at your unit (access differs by branch/region).
    2. Request a printed or emailed copy from your local branch HR — this is the most reliable method for most field staff.
    3. Keep your EPF UAN and ESIC number handy, since these are needed to verify PF/ESI credits independently on the EPFO and ESIC portals.

    If you have a salary query or need a contact number for a specific site or branch, the fastest way is to check the HR contact printed on your own appointment letter or payslip, or reach out through the official SIS India website’s contact page — city/branch numbers change frequently, so an old number found online may not be current.

    City-Wise SIS Security Salary (Indicative)

    Because pay is tied to each state’s minimum wage notification for security guards, the same SIS designation pays differently across cities. These are approximate, indicative ranges, not official city-wise pay scales published by SIS:

    City/State Approx. Gross Salary (8 hrs) Notes
    Delhi ₹18,000 – ₹24,000 Among the highest in India; Delhi’s minimum wage for security staff is one of the highest nationally
    Mumbai ₹16,000 – ₹20,000 Higher at corporate/bank sites
    Bangalore ₹15,000 – ₹19,000 12-hour postings can push in-hand pay to ₹20,000+
    Jaipur ₹12,000 – ₹18,000 Rajasthan minimum wage-linked; varies by site type
    Varanasi ₹11,000 – ₹16,000 Uttar Pradesh tier-2 city rates apply
    Siliguri ₹10,500 – ₹16,000 West Bengal tier-2 city rates apply
    Ahmedabad ₹12,500 – ₹18,000 Gujarat minimum wage-linked
    Odisha (state average) ₹10,500 – ₹16,500 Varies between Bhubaneswar/Cuttack and smaller towns

    Estimated/Indicative — always confirm current pay with your local SIS branch, as state minimum wages are revised periodically (commonly every six months).

    Common Salary Mistakes to Avoid

    • Confusing gross salary with in-hand salary when comparing job offers between SIS and another agency.
    • Assuming 12-hour shift pay is simply double the 8-hour rate — it is higher due to OT, but not a flat multiplication.
    • Ignoring that EPF is your own money, not a loss — 12% goes into your retirement account, matched by the employer.
    • Comparing salary across cities without accounting for the local minimum wage — a lower number in a tier-2 city may still be fair relative to that state’s wage floor.
    • Relying on old salary figures found online — minimum wages change roughly twice a year, so a rate from 18 months ago may already be outdated.

    Conclusion Of SIS Security Salary

    The SIS Security salary is best understood as a minimum-wage-anchored, shift-and-city-dependent structure rather than one fixed number. An 8-hour shift guard can expect an in-hand salary roughly in the ₹12,000–₹15,500 range, while a 12-hour shift — thanks to overtime — can push take-home pay to ₹16,000–₹21,500. Supervisors and officers earn meaningfully more. The real driver of your final in-hand number is a combination of your posting city’s minimum wage, the client site type, your shift length, and standard EPF/ESI deductions. Always verify current figures with your local SIS branch or your own payslip rather than relying solely on averages.

    FAQs About SIS Security Salary

    1. What is the SIS Security salary per month for a fresher guard?

    A fresher joining on an 8-hour shift typically earns a gross salary of ₹14,000–₹18,000/month, with in-hand pay around ₹12,000–₹15,500 after EPF and ESI deductions. Exact figures depend on the city and client site.

    2. SIS Security ka salary kitna hai?

    Entry-level SIS Security guards generally earn between ₹12,000 and ₹21,500 in hand per month, depending on whether it’s an 8-hour or 12-hour shift and the city of posting.

    3. What is the difference between SIS Security salary 8 hours and 12 hours?

    The 12-hour shift includes daily overtime, which raises gross pay from roughly ₹14,000–₹18,000 to ₹19,000–₹25,000/month, and in-hand pay from ₹12,000–₹15,500 to ₹16,000–₹21,500.

    4. Is PF deducted from SIS Security salary?

    Yes. SIS deducts 12% of Basic+DA as the employee’s EPF contribution, and matches it with an equal 12% employer contribution, as required for organised-sector employers.

    5. How do I get my SIS Security salary slip online?

    Salary slips are generated through SIS’s internal payroll system. Employees should request access or a copy through their site supervisor or local branch HR, since self-service access can vary by branch/region.

    6. What is the highest salary in SIS Security?

    At the field level, experienced supervisors and security officers in metro cities can earn ₹28,000–₹32,000 in hand. Branch and operations management roles above this are paid on a separate CTC structure with fixed and variable components.

    7. Does SIS Security salary differ between cities like Jaipur, Delhi, and Mumbai?

    Yes. Because pay is linked to each state’s minimum wage notification, Delhi and Mumbai generally offer higher gross salaries than Jaipur, Varanasi, or Siliguri for the same guard designation.
